In a perfect world, editors and manuscript staff would not be overworked, all organizations and repositories would have unlimited funds and volunteers to notify everyone of every little change and all ready reference would always be 100% up to date. That said, if we all do as much as we can to be sure than any contact changes are broadcast far and wide, and editors make an effort to confirm content between editions, the books will be that much better. Sometimes though, neither seems to occur.
 
After reading about the Genealogist's Address Book website in a newsletter, I visited and noted a few things I new were out of date for my area. I tried emailing and the email bounced back. If the email is bad, how am I to know that "spending" the time to write a letter and mail it won't bounce as well? Many organizations and repositories don't have unlimited resources to try one contact avenue after another. I'm sure this type of thing seems minor, but these irregularities add up and compound the "problem". I'm not sure there is one solution. My suggestion, if you see out of date listings online or with an email attached - try sending an update. It costs you the time for the email and nothing else.
